Skye Camanachd Saturday Shinty Shorts | |
16 September 2017 It was trophy day for the Skye Camanachd first team at Pairc nan Laoch, Portree. The Skye Camanachd first team beat at battling Inveraray side 3-0 in their Marine Harvest National Division encounter at Pairc nan Laoch, Portree on Saturday 16 September 2017. A blistering Will Cowie strike from wide on the left on 37 minutes was the only goal of the first half. Iain MacLellan added a second on 73 minutes after Inveraray goalie Scott MacLachlan had made a great save from Danny Morrison. James Pringle added a third 5 minutes from time when he sent the ball low into the net from a central position. With Camanachd Association President-elect Keith Loades in attendance, Skye Camanachd were presented with the Marine Harvest National Division trophy by John Angus Gillies from sponsors Marine Harvest. The teams also contested the 2016 Thomas Ferguson Memorial Cup and Skye captain Kenny Campbell received this trophy from former Skye player Sammy Gordon. The Skye Camanachd second team have completed their competitive fixtures for the season. Skye Camanachd Ladies were to play Lovat Ladies in a Marine Harvest National Division 1 match at Pairc nan Laoch, Portree on Saturday 16 September 2017. However Lovat were unable to raise a team so Skye have been awarded the points. Skye Camanachd U17 were to play Fort William U17 in a London Shield encounter on Tuesday 12 September 2017 but the game was postponed as An Aird was unplayable. Skye Camanachd U14 recorded a fine 6-5 win against MacMaster Cup finalists Lochaber U14 in their Marine Harvest North Division 2 match at Pairc nan Laoch, Portree on Friday 15 September 2017. Taylor Matheson scored five times for Skye whilst Liam MacQueen got the other. This was a very good game and a terrific Skye performance. |
